400-0435-005 2 SPECIAL APPLICATION ABOUT YOUR TP115-111 2 TECHNICAL SPECIFICATIONS 3 TP115-111 COMPUTER/COMPONENT TWISTED PAIR (TP) TO VIDEO + AUDIO RECEIVER The TP115-111 receives computer video and audio signals over Twisted Pair-type (CAT-5) cable when used together with an ALTINEX Twisted Pair transmitter, such as the TP115-110. As with the TP115-110, the TP115-111 is streamlined and lightweight for applications that have small space requirements. The unit offers video equalization for up to 400 ft (122 m) and signal detect shows when a signal is present. The latest generation of Twisted Pair devices uses an innovative, patented technology* developed by ALTINEX. The new signal processing technology allows transmitting and receiving fully equalized computer video signals, stereo, and audio signals over long distances. The maximum distance at full UXGA resolution is 400 ft (122 m) between devices and may reach up to 750 ft (230 m) at VGA resolution. Determine the best location for the TP115-110 and TP115-111. Where possible, locate the TP115-110 as close to the video source as possible and the TP115-111 as close to the receiving component as feasible. Step 2. Apply power to the TP115-110 using the power adaptor provided. The Power LED should be on and red. Step 3. Connect the video source to the input of the TP115-110 using a high-quality video cable. Step 4. The Power LED should change from red to green indicating a signal is present. Step 5. Connect the audio input source to the audio jack on the TP115-110. Step 6. Run a CAT-5 cable from the 4TP OUTPUT of the TP115-110 to the 4TP INPUT on the TP115-111. NOTE: Ensure good signal transmission by routing the cable avoiding any sharp angles, creases, or bends. Step 7. Connect the TP115-111 video and audio outputs to their receiving devices. NOTE: The L+, L-and GND outputs on the TP115-111 terminal block output contain the mono audio output signal. The R+ and R- pins are not used. Step 8. Apply power to the TP115-111 using the power adaptor provided. The Power LED should be on and red; green if a signal is present. Step 9. The units are now operational. The TP115-111 requires only one adjustment to be made for optimal performance. The adjustment is video equalization for long cable lengths. 7.1 VIDEO EQUALIZATION Video equalization is provided to fine-tune the displayed image on the remote display. Typically, the equalization will be set to near minimum for short cable runs. Cable lengths up to 400 ft (122 m) will require near maximum equalization. The equalization adjustment on the TP115-111 works together with the TP115-110 to provide equalization for maximum cable lengths. For example, for cable runs less than 50 ft (15 m), both equalization settings may be set to near minimum. Cable runs of 400 ft (122 m) will see equalization settings at about the three-quarter position. 400-0435-005 7 SPECIAL APPLICATION TROUBLESHOOTING GUIDE 8 We have carefully tested and have found no problems in the supplied TP115-111.
